Part Overview
The CD4541BPWRG4 is a programmable timer IC manufactured by Texas Instruments, designed for clock and timing applications with a maximum frequency of 100kHz and a 65536-count capacity. The device operates across a wide supply voltage range of 3V to 20V and temperature range of -55°C to 125°C, packaged in a 14-TSSOP surface mount configuration.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ation
Substitution eligibility for the CD4541BPWRG4 is determined by the following critical parameters:
- Package compatibility: 14-TSSOP surface mount form factor
- Functional classification: Programmable Timer IC
- Supply voltage range: Minimum 3V to 20V support
- Operating temperature range: -55°C to 125°C coverage
- RoHS and environmental compliance: ROHS3 Compliant status
- Moisture sensitivity: MSL 1 rating
The CD4541BPWRG4 has two qualified substitutes that meet these criteria. Both alternatives maintain identical packaging, compliance certifications, and core functional specifications while differing in frequency capability and supply voltage upper limits.

Engineering Selection Recommendations
CD4541BPWR is the primary substitute for CD4541BPWRG4. Both parts are manufactured by Texas Instruments with identical electrical specifications, frequency rating, and supply voltage range. The CD4541BPWR maintains active product status with higher inventory availability (5144 pcs in stock versus 815 pcs for the original part). Packaging differs only in format designation (Tape & Reel versus standard packaging), with no impact on component functionality or PCB integration.
MC14541BDTR2G is a secondary substitute manufactured by onsemi. This part maintains identical package geometry, temperature range, and compliance certifications. The maximum supply voltage is reduced to 18V (versus 20V for the CD4541 series), and the frequency capability is increased to 3MHz. This substitute is suitable for applications where the 100kHz frequency specification is not a limiting factor and the 18V maximum supply voltage is compatible with system design requirements.
Both substitutes are ROHS3 compliant with MSL 1 rating, ensuring compatibility with standard manufacturing and storage protocols.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can CD4541BPWR be used as a direct replacement for CD4541BPWRG4?
A: Yes. Both parts share identical electrical specifications, frequency rating (100kHz), supply voltage range (3V ~ 20V), operating temperature range (-55°C ~ 125°C), and 14-TSSOP package geometry. The only difference is packaging format (Tape & Reel versus standard). No circuit modifications are required.
Q: What are the key differences between CD4541BPWR and MC14541BDTR2G?
A: The primary differences are manufacturer (Texas Instruments versus onsemi), frequency capability (100kHz versus 3MHz), and maximum supply voltage (20V versus 18V). Both maintain identical package form factor and temperature range. Selection depends on whether the application requires the 100kHz frequency specification and whether the 18V maximum supply voltage is acceptable.
Q: Is the 14-TSSOP package identical across all three parts?
A: Yes. All three parts use the 14-TSSOP package with 0.173" width and 4.40mm dimensions. PCB footprints and mounting procedures are identical.
Q: Are all substitutes RoHS compliant?
A: Yes. CD4541BPWR and MC14541BDTR2G are both ROHS3 compliant with MSL 1 rating, matching the original CD4541BPWRG4 specifications.
Q: Which substitute should be selected for new designs?
A: CD4541BPWR is recommended for direct replacement applications requiring 100kHz operation and 20V maximum supply voltage. MC14541BDTR2G is suitable for applications where higher frequency capability (3MHz) is beneficial and the 18V maximum supply voltage is compatible with system requirements.
